Overview

Wink follows unhappy housewife Sofie and her breadwinning husband Gregor who both seek weekly counseling from an unorthodox therapist, Doctor Frans. Their current topic of disagreement: the cat, Wink. When Wink goes missing, violent desires, domestic anarchy and feline vengeance emerge, threatening the neatly ordered reality Sophie, Gregor and Doctor Frans have constructed.

Jen Silverman

Jen Silverman

Jen Silverman (they/them) is a playwright, novelist and screenwriter. Plays include: The Roommate (Broadway: The Booth Theatre; Regionally: Williamstown Theatre Festival, Actor’s Theatre of Louisville Humana Festival, Steppenwolf, South Coast Repertory Theatre, etc.); Highway ...
